The principle of a book summary itself has some particular advantages and downsides. Naturally, these will move to Blinkist and any other book summary service. You can’t truly blame a specific business for them.
Let’s first take a look at those, so we can better determine the special benefits and drawbacks of Blinkist later on.
Pros of checking out book summaries:.
You’ll skip all unneeded details. This is specifically valuable for books that only make one or a couple of assets. It also helps you prevent bad books completely.
You can learn about more and various topics much faster. Instead of being stuck on one book about meditation for a month, you can check out a summary in a few minutes. Then, you can leap to the next mindfulness book or a brand-new subject altogether.
You’ll likely remember more without keeping in mind. Since book summaries focus around realities and brief ways to illustrate them, you’ll likely leave from one summary with 3-5 things you’ll remember. It’s tough to effectively memorize anything if you check out a complete book without taking notes.
Cons of checking out book summaries:.
You’ll lose the majority of the story and humor of the book. This is bad, due to the fact that it makes reading enjoyable. Depending upon how much you get in touch with the story, it also assists you keep in mind a lot, even if you may need to remember.
The finest books strike hard with every page. Some books you just have to check out in full to get the most out of them.
Due to an absence of context, you may interpret realities the wrong way. Often, a summary mentions an idea one method, whereas the context of the book sets it up in another. But because that context is now missing out on, you’re interpreting the concept differently and hence get an impression the author didn’t desire you to have.
You are now relying on not simply the author of the book, however likewise whoever composed the summary. You lose if the summary author does a bad task. They may fail to include a crucial story and so you will not keep in mind a crucial fact.

First, the Blinkist app is offered for both iPhone and Android. Downloading the app is free. You can register using your e-mail address or Facebook account. When you open the app for the first time, you’ll get a short tutorial of how everything works.
One of the first things you’ll see is that the app only has 3 tabs for you to select from:.
Discover. This is where you can explore their library and find new titles.
Library. Here, you’ll have access to your personal choice of books.
You. This is where your settings and conserved highlights are.
This is dazzling, due to the fact that it makes navigating the app and choosing what to do truly simple. Let’s look at the private tabs.
